## Provenance: Pagination Layer, Larkstone Public API

The cursor-based pagination module in the Larkstone REST API is built from the api-core repo and signed at packaging time. Reviewers should confirm that cursor encoding changes bump the schema version and that the attestation matches the merged commit. Opaque cursors must never leak row offsets. The provenance record for the current reviewed build follows.

build token for kagaf-hahof: htk14_9d3d4d26d7d8de

Subject: DR Drill — Pointsledger, Thursday

Team,

Thursday we rehearse restoring the Pointsledger loyalty-points ledger from cold backups in the Varnholt region. Reviewers: please confirm the restore scripts match the approved runbook before the drill. During the exercise, the backup archive must be unsealed manually; the recovery passphrase is provided below.

vault phrase of yawig-bawig = fenael-norael-eliox-gilox-casath-druath-zorys-istwyn-jorwyn

## Configuration

Stagelight renders seat maps for the Orvane Theatre from venue JSON. Set SEATMAP_VENUE=orvane and SEATMAP_CACHE_TTL=300 in .env. Releases must pin the renderer image; floating tags break the hold-seat overlay. Pricing tiers come from the box-office API, which requires an access secret. Add that line to the .env file directly after this sentence.

secret setting of bajeg-yahog: LEDGER_TOKEN20=f833f3e2e6625ec0dee3

- [ ] **Step 7: Breaker override escrow.** After sealing the signing keys for the Tallgrove upstream API circuit breaker, confirm the support team can force the breaker open during a full outage. The override bundle lives in the sealed escrow drawer and is useless without its unlock phrase. Two ceremony witnesses must initial this step before proceeding. The escrow bundle is decrypted with the recovery passphrase that follows.

vault phrase of kahip-kahop = holath-quenmir

**Lost your badge? Here's the drill.**

It happens — don't panic. First, ping the Oakhurst facilities inbox so they can kill the old badge before anyone else uses it. Then head to the ground-floor security pod at Vessel House with some photo ID and they'll sort you a loaner for the day. Loaners don't open the print room or the third-floor archive. For those, use the temporary access code below.

door code, yagap-bahof: bdg-O-05